Description

The Dean Vendetta VN 1.7 is designed for musicians who crave versatility and power in a sleek, solid body electric guitar. With a 24-fret rosewood fingerboard, this guitar offers an extensive range of notes ideal for intricate solos and expressive style. Equipped with dual Dean humbuckers, it delivers a robust sound that can effortlessly switch from clean to heavy. The bolt-on maple neck ensures durability and stability, making it perfect for both practice sessions and live performances.

The Vendetta VN 1.7 is crafted with an arched basswood body, providing a balanced tonal quality that suits a variety of musical genres. Its string-through-body construction not only enhances sustain but also adds to the guitar's overall aesthetic appeal. The guitar features a tune-o-matic bridge for precise intonation, ensuring your sound stays true, whether you're in the studio or on stage.

A combination of functionality and style, the Vendetta VN 1.7 offers easy access to upper frets thanks to its deep cutaways. It caters to both beginners and seasoned players looking for a reliable instrument that can keep up with their evolving musical journey.

One of the best 7 strings I've played

Perfect guitar for those who want a guitar for upgrades and do some future mods Light body(maybe too much, some people migh not like it honestly) "Normal" scale, but doesnt suffer too much going on lower tunings Original pickups are kinda meh, but not unusable for shure Tuning machines also kinda meh, but fair enought for the price
